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ated wood siding and installing new panels to restore the appearance and integrity of a property's exterior. This process typically includes assessing the existing siding, carefully removing compromised sections, and fitting new wood siding that matches the original style and dimensions. Skilled contractors ensure proper installation techniques to prevent future issues, such as water infiltration or uneven expansion, which can compromise the structure’s durability.
This service addresses common problems associated with aging or damaged wood siding, including rotting, warping, cracking, and insect infestation. Over time, exposure to weather elements can weaken the siding, leading to aesthetic decline and potential structural concerns. Replacing worn or compromised siding helps improve the property's curb appeal, enhances weather resistance, and prevents further deterioration that could lead to more costly repairs down the line.

Material Costs - The cost of wood siding materials varies widely, typically ranging from $3 to $8 per square foot. Higher-quality or specialty woods can increase expenses, especially for custom or premium options.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for wood siding replacement gener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. Factors such as home size and complexity can influence total labor charges by local contractors.
Total Project Costs - Overall expenses for replacing wood siding usually range from $5,000 to $15,000 for an average-sized home. Larger or more intricate projects tend to be on the higher end of this spectrum.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include surface preparation, removal of old siding, or repairs, which can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ars. These charges depend on the condition of existing siding and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How long does wood siding replacement typically take? The duration of wood siding replacement varies depending on the size of the project and the condition of the existing siding.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ific needs.
What are the common signs that wood siding needs to be replaced? Signs include rotting, warping, cracking, or extensive pest damage. Noticing these issues may indicate the need for professional assessment and replacement services.
Can existing wood siding be repaired instead of replaced? In some cases, repairs are possible, but extensive damage often requires full replacement. Consulting with local siding specialists can help determine the best solution.
What types of wood siding are available for replacement? Options include cedar, redwood, pine, and engineered wood siding. Local providers can advise on the best type suited for specific aesthetic and durability preferences.
